This is technical and responsible work in the planning, scheduling, marketing and coordination of specific programs at designated recreational facilities. This work involves supervising and organizing activities for participants of varying ages. Work is performed under general supervision of a Recreation Supervisor. Working special events on holidays, nights, and weekends will be required. Essential Job Duties: Plans, coordinates and supervises various recreational activities, games, programs, field trips, events and sporting activities for age groups between pre-school aged to senior citizens Supervise a specified group of participants (adults and children) indoors and outdoors, some with special needs. Provide and maintain a safe environment for the participants and complete injury and/or incident reports, as required. Conduct Crisis Response Drills, Fire Drills, and all emergency preparedness procedures; Assist with routine maintenance as assigned inside and outside of facility. Drive recreation van on required field trips Perform other duties as assigned. Foster positive employee relations and employee morale on a City-wide basis. For the On-Call Recreation Leader: Employee is responsible on an as-needed basis for assisting in the planning, organizing, and coordinating comprehensive recreational programs. This includes but is not limited to short-term community interest classes, cultural programs, special events, front desk shifts, and rentals on an as needed basis. The incumbent may conduct, participate in and/or supervise leisure activities for all ages. Minimum Qualifications: High School graduation or possession of an acceptable equivalency diploma, at least 18 years of age at time of application Six (6) months of verifiable experience in childcare, recreation programming, customer service or related field. Must possess a valid State of Florida Driver's License, with a good driving record. Must possess or obtain CPR, AED, and First Aid Certification within 30 days of hire. Child Development Accreditation preferred. Knowledge of Logic Pro 10 for positions assigned to 505 Teen Center Recording Studio Additional for Out Of School Programs: Have all current certification requirements including but not limited to valid and current 45-hour childcare license, and all other certifications as required by City, County and State for After-School program. CDL license is a plus. Ability to pass scheduled physical exams in compliance with Florida Department of Health. High School Student Employees Applicable For 505 Teen Center: Must be in High School, at least 16 years of age at time of application. Six (6) months of verifiable volunteer or paid experience in childcare, recreation programming or related field. Must possess a valid State of Florida Driver's License or Learners Permit. Must possess or obtain CPR, AED, and First Aid Certification within 30 days of hire.
